Nginx安装配置

本博文介绍Nginx在Windows 10、Ubuntu16.04、Centos7下的安装方法

Linux安装方法主要参考官网:http://nginx.org/en/linux_packages.html

 

Windows 10

在Windows下安装相对简单,只需要下载安装包,解压即可。

1.下载安装包

http://nginx.org/en/download.html,选择Stable version(最新的稳定版本)下载

2.解压安装

右键ngin-1.16.0.zip-->解压到当前文件夹

得到如下文件夹

3.启动

进入解压后的文件夹nginx-1.16.0,双击nginx.exe启动nginx服务器

4.测试

浏览器输入localhost:80或者localhost,看到Welcome to nginx为安装成功。

 

Ubuntu16.04

1.安装必要的包

sudo apt install curl gnupg2 ca-certificates lsb-release

2.设置apt仓库安装最新稳定版本的nginx,执行以下命令

echo "deb http://nginx.org/packages/ubuntu `lsb_release -cs` nginx" \
    | sudo tee /etc/apt/sources.list.d/nginx.list

3.导入官方签名密钥

curl -fsSL https://nginx.org/keys/nginx_signing.key | sudo apt-key add -

 4.验证key

sudo apt-key fingerprint ABF5BD827BD9BF62

执行后会有如下输出 

pub   rsa2048 2011-08-19 [SC] [expires: 2024-06-14]

      573B FD6B 3D8F BC64 1079  A6AB ABF5 BD82 7BD9 BF62 

uid   [ unknown] nginx signing key <signing-key@nginx.com>

 

5.安装nginx

sudo apt update
sudo apt install nginx

 6.启动nginx

service nginx start

7.测试

浏览器输入ip:80或主机名称:80

Centos7

1.安装必要的包

sudo yum install yum-utils

2.新建nginx.repo文件

sudo nano /etc/yum.repos.d/nginx.repo

nginx.repo文件内容如下:

[nginx-stable]
name=nginx stable repo
baseurl=http://nginx.org/packages/centos/$releasever/$basearch/
gpgcheck=1
enabled=1
gpgkey=https://nginx.org/keys/nginx_signing.key

[nginx-mainline]
name=nginx mainline repo
baseurl=http://nginx.org/packages/mainline/centos/$releasever/$basearch/
gpgcheck=1
enabled=0
gpgkey=https://nginx.org/keys/nginx_signing.key

4.安装nginx

sudo yum install nginx

5.启动nginx

sudo service nginx start

6.测试

 

 

完成! enjoy it!

 

  • 1
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值